Explanation: E) In the body of a request making a claim or requesting adjustments, you should give a complete, specific explanation of the details; provide any information an adjuster would need to verify your complaint.

Explanation: D) If you're dissatisfied with a company's product or service, you can opt to make a claim or request an adjustment. In either case, it's important to maintain a professional tone in all your communication, no matter how angry or frustrated you are. Keeping your cool will help you get the situation resolved sooner.
